- Closed Session to Discuss Pending Litigation
A motion was made by Council Member Piagentini, seconded by Council Member Dorsey, that the Committee enter into closed session, pursuant to KRS 61.810(1)(c), to discuss pending litigation. The motion carried by a voice vote, and the Committee entered into closed session at 5:22 p.m. A motion was made by Council Member Fowler, seconded by Council Member Dorsey, that the Committee reconvene in open session. The motion carried by a voice vote and the Committee reconvened in open session at 5:38 p.m. p.m. Council President James stated that, pursuant to KRS 61.815(1)(c), no final action was taken during the closed session.
